As the Senior Manager Financial Planning & Analysis, you will lead a team of Business Partners and Analysts to provide internal stakeholders with high-quality financial analysis and accurate and timely visibility of the organisation’s financial performance.
You will be responsible for all financial and management reporting and play a lead role in planning the organisation’s budget and forecast processes and together with your team, build our financial management capability via a business partnering model.
You will also be accountable for financial due diligence processes, including financial and risk analysis, modelling, and recommendations for major projects, strategic growth initiatives and tenders.
